An historical epic set in the Tudor court about the most infamous woman of the age - Anne Boleyn - and the man who loved her before she became queen. From the moment Henry Percy first glimpses Anne he is captivated and quickly proposes marriage. But a match of the heart has no place in a world where marriage is a political manoeuvre.

A year on from the mysterious disappearance of Jenny Bercival, DI Wesley Peterson is called in when the body of a strangled woman is found floating out to sea in a dinghy. The discovery mars the festivities of the Palkin Festival, held each year to celebrate the life of John Palkin, a 14th century Mayor of Tradmouth who made his fortune from trade

Inspector Andy Horton's holiday peace is shattered when stepping out across an abandoned golf course on the Isle of Wight when he finds himself facing a distraught young woman with a gun in her hand, leaning over a corpse in one of the discarded bunkers. A web of secrets is soon revealed. Originally published: 2010

Inspector Alvarez is just considering whether he can leave early for the day without being detected when Tomeu, a policeman from Port Lluesco with whom Alvarez has enjoyed many a night out, calls to tell him that an Englishman has been found dead in his car in his garage, the engine switched on and the tank empty.
